Title: Which PDF library does VirtueMart use to get PDF's so accurate?
Post by: mailblade on November 28, 2018, 14:34:08 PM
I was wondering which PDF library/component VirtueMart uses to generate the PDF's.

It keeps all the formatting, styling etc. of your order details view and transfers it onto the PDF.

If someone could point me to the file which handles all this I'd appreciate it.
Title: Re: Which PDF library does VirtueMart use to get PDF's so accurate?
Post by: StefanSTS on November 28, 2018, 14:43:33 PM
Hello,

the library is called TCPDF.

The files you are looking for are located in /components/com_virtuemart/views/invoice/tmpl/
There are four files with the beginning invoice.

Overrides should be placed in the template folder adding .... /html/com_virtuemart/invoice/
